Applying for a car loan can be a significant financial decision that requires careful consideration. Whether you are opting for a new car or exploring options for a used car loan , it’s crucial to evaluate several aspects before making your choice. Securing a car loan isn’t just about finding one with the lowest interest rates; it’s about comprehensively understanding your financial situation and establishing what makes sense for you in the long run.
The Importance of Your Credit Score
One of the primary factors to consider is your credit score. Lenders use your credit history as a benchmark to determine your creditworthiness, affecting the interest rate you are offered. Before starting the loan application process, it is advisable to check your credit score and rectify any errors that could adversely impact it. Achieving a good credit score could mean the difference between a competitive interest rate and an unmanageable loan agreement.
Setting a Realistic Budget
Additionally, understanding your budget is crucial when applying for a car loan. Establish how much you can realistically afford to repay monthly, including insurance, maintenance, and other associated costs. It is tempting to stretch your budget for a more luxurious model, but the long term financial strain might outweigh the temporary satisfaction of driving a more expensive vehicle.
Choosing the Right Loan Term
Another key consideration is the loan term. Generally, car loan terms can vary between 36 to 72 months. While a longer term might seem attractive because of lower monthly payments, it frequently results in a higher overall interest expenditure. Always calculate the total cost of the loan over various terms to determine which option is most beneficial for your financial situation.
Comparing Interest Rates
Interest rates, without a doubt, play a significant role in defining the cost of your car loan. These rates are influenced not only by your credit score but also by broader economic factors and lender policies. It might be worth comparing offers from different lenders to secure a favourable rate. Don’t forget to consider whether a fixed or variable interest rate would suit your financial strategy better.
The Role of the Down Payment
The down payment is another vital component of the car loan process. A larger down payment can reduce the amount you need to borrow, potentially lowering your monthly payments and interest rates. Assess how much money you can comfortably put down without impairing your financial stability. This step might also influence the lender’s decision and the terms you are offered.
Reviewing Loan Terms and Conditions
Moreover, carefully reviewing all terms and conditions of the loan agreement is imperative. Pay attention to details such as prepayment penalties, late fees, or any other hidden charges that could cost you more in the long run. Clarify any ambiguous areas with your lender or a financial advisor to ensure complete understanding before you commit.
Additional Lender Features and Benefits
It’s also worth considering the specific features or benefits that different lenders may offer, such as payment holidays or no early repayment charges. Such features can provide additional flexibility and peace of mind, particularly if your financial circumstances were to change.
Considering Vehicle Depreciation
Lastly, understanding the impact of depreciation on car loans, especially when opting for a new vehicle, is crucial. Cars typically depreciate quickly, and owing more than the car’s value can lead to negative equity. It’s essential to factor this into any decisions you make when applying for finance.
To conclude, applying for a car loan requires a thorough understanding of your finances and a strategic approach to borrowing. By taking the time to research and consider these various factors, you can find a car loan that aligns with your financial goals and circumstances.
